  • Patent number: 6315282
    Abstract: An apparatus capable of performing pick operations on multiple sizes in a printing device is disclosed. This apparatus separates a media sheet from a stack and drives it along a media path. The apparatus also corrects any pick skew of the media sheet caused during the pick operation before the media sheet is transferred to the drive roller. By ensuring that the traversing media sheet has a leveled leading edge, the pick skew of the media sheet is substantially eliminated.

  • Patent number: 6152440
    Abstract: A sheet media handling system for aligned feeding of sheet media of different widths is disclosed. This sheet media handling system caters to a wide-format printer which has two media trays, a main tray and a bypass tray positioned above the main tray. In such a printer, a larger width sheet medium in the bypass tray is insufficiently supported when a stack of smaller width sheet media is present in the main tray. Such a situation may result in skewing or jamming of the larger width sheet medium. The sheet media handling system overcomes such a problem by having a secondary pressure plate in addition to a primary pressure plate. This secondary pressure plate is moveable independently of the primary pressure plate so that the secondary pressure plate is operable to provide appropriate support for the partially supported larger width sheet medium in the bypass tray.

  • Patent number: 6139011
    Abstract: A printer having a facility for manually directing a printing medium along a printing medium path. The printer includes an external housing, a drive roller arranged about an axis of rotation for feeding a printing medium through a processing zone of the printer, a control member arranged about an axis of rotation, and movable between a first axial position in which the control member protrudes from said external housing so as to be manually actuable, and a second axial position in which the control member is retracted relative to the first axial position, and a coupling mechanism selectively coupling the control member and the feed roller to translate rotational movement of the control member into rotational movement of the feed roller, said coupling mechanism being engaged when the control member is in the first axial position and disengaged when the control member is in the second axial position.
